Karnataka’s Gruhalakshmi Scheme supports women by giving Rs 2000 every month directly to their bank accounts. If you haven’t received your Gruhalakshmi amount in 2025, this guide will help you check your payment status and fix common problems.

Understanding the Karnataka Gruhalakshmi Scheme

This scheme helps women, especially housewives, homeless women, and female farm workers, by providing monthly financial support of Rs 2000. The money is sent through Direct Benefit Transfer (DBT) into the beneficiary’s bank account. Around 1.28 crore women in Karnataka get help from this scheme.

Common Reasons for Gruhalakshmi Amount Not Received and Solutions

  • If you or your husband pay taxes, you are not eligible for the payment.
  • Check if your Aadhaar E-KYC is updated.
  • Make sure your ration card status is active and E-KYC is current.
  • If the woman is not listed as the family head on the ration card, this might cause problems.
  • Your bank account must be linked with your Aadhaar card for payment.

1. Beneficiary and Husband Should Not Be Taxpayers

If either you or your husband pay income tax, you cannot get benefits from the Gruhalakshmi Scheme. This scheme is for non-government employees and non-taxpayers living under BPL or marginal conditions.

2. Update Your Aadhaar E-KYC

Your Aadhaar verification must be up to date because the payments are made through DBT. To update E-KYC, visit your local Bangalore One, Grama One, or Common Service Centre (CSC). Keeping this info current helps avoid payment failures.

3. Link Aadhaar with Ration Card and Keep It Active

Make sure your Aadhaar card is linked with your ration card and that your ration card is active. Whether you have an APL, BPL, or Antyodaya card, an inactive card can block payments. Visit your ration shop to check and update your card’s E-KYC status.

4. Make the Woman the Head of the Family on the Ration Card

For payment under Gruhalakshmi, the woman beneficiary should be listed as the head of the family on the ration card. You can apply to change this at your ration shop or nearby CSC.

5. Keep the Beneficiary Name the Same on All Documents

The name on Aadhaar, ration card, and bank passbook should match exactly. If there are differences, update them by visiting your bank for the passbook and CSC for Aadhaar or ration card corrections.

6. Link Bank Account with Aadhaar and Mobile Number

Payments only go through when your bank account is linked with your Aadhaar. If it’s not linked, contact your bank to update this. You can check your Aadhaar NPCI status online to confirm the linkage.

7. Visit the Taluk Women and Child Development Office for Help

If after checking all these steps, you still haven’t received payments, visit your Taluk Women and Child Development Department office. They can offer advice and help solve your problem.
